Non-LTE modeling of multifluid plasmas
POSTER
Abstract
We present a collisional-radiative model to simulate non-LTE plasmas using the classical multifluid approximation. The effect of non-zero relative drift velocities of the colliding particles is taken into account in the rate formulation\footnote{Le \& Cambier, PoP \textbf{22}, 093512 (2015), PoP \textbf{23}, 063505 (2016).}. We show that the multifluid collision rates deviate from standard results when the kinetic energy of the relative drift motion is comparable to the average thermal energy. Numerical results are presented to demonstrate the impact of this effect on the overall kinetics of the system.
